美文网首页
创建对象内存分析

创建对象内存分析

作者: 哈迪斯Java | 来源:发表于2021-09-22 16:31 被阅读0次

创建对象内存分析:
package oop.Demon3;

public class Application {
public static void main(String[] args) {

    Pet dog = new Pet();
    dog.name = "旺财";
    dog.age = 3;
    dog.shout();

    System.out.println(dog.name);
    System.out.println(dog.age);
}

}

第二个文件:

package oop.Demon3;

public class Pet {
public String name;
public int age;

//无参构造
public void shout(){
    System.out.println("叫了一声");
}

}

相关文章

  • 创建对象内存分析

    创建对象内存分析:package oop.Demon3; public class Application {pu...

  • 类的结构分析

    类分析初探 基于isa结构分析 ,我们可以通过lldb获取对象的内存情况 创建一个Person类对象 查看类对象的...

  • alloc的探究

    alloc 分析 对于alloc 系统会创建一个内存对象,并在栈中创建一个对象指针只想对象的地址空间。init操作...

  • golang 逃逸分析_v1.0.0

    逃逸分析是golang编译器分析一个对象到底应该放到堆内存上,还是栈内存上逃逸是指在某个方法之内创建的对象,除了在...

  • 第五章:面向对象基础——类与对象进一步研究 。

    本章目标 掌握Java中的内存划分 初窥Java引用传递 垃圾的产生分析 内存划分:对象创建之初 声明对象:Per...

  • IOS 对象内存的开辟

    IOS对象的创建中分析到了对象的创建在alloc函数,而实现alloc的主要有三个步骤 而对象内存的开辟主要是在前...

  • 【JVM】2、对象(Hot Spot虚拟机)

    对象的创建类加载分配内存方式方案对象初始化对象头(Object Header)设置创建完成 对象的内存分布对象头实...

  • Java对象内存分析

    此处对象内存分析只针对Java基本对象,暂不对集合对象进行剖析。 内存 栈内存 堆内存

  • JVM 常见内容汇总

    面试题 对象 对象的创建 分配内存 对象头 内存溢出 内存溢出与内存泄漏 内存溢出:系统无法再分配内存空间。 内存...

  • android性能优化篇(二)内存抖动和内存泄漏

    内存抖动指段时间内大量对象创建和销毁,伴随着频繁的gc 具体在androidstudio中用分析内存,找到频繁gc...

网友评论

      本文标题:创建对象内存分析

      本文链接:https://www.haomeiwen.com/subject/mphggltx.html